Kerry looks forward to getting back in the saddle
By Agence France-Presse in Washington | China Daily | Updated: 2015-06-16 07:45
US Secretary of State John Kerry is taking nothing more than Tylenol for his broken leg after a low-speed bike accident, he said in an interview published on Sunday.
Kerry, who remains deeply engaged in the Iranian nuclear talks that have taken place over the past 18 months, told The Boston Globe that the narcotics doctors prescribed for him were having undesired effects.
"All I'm taking is Tylenol," he said in an interview on Saturday. "After I got two or three days in, I said, 'You've got to stop this crap.'"
